Abstract: | The molecules of dispiro1,3‐dithietane‐2,2′:4,2′′‐diadamantane], C20H28S2, have crystallographic Ci symmetry, as well as local D2h symmetry, and a planar 1,3‐dithietane ring. The molecules of trispiro1,3,5‐trithiane‐2,2′:4,2′′:6,2′′′‐triadamantane], C30H42S3, have approximate C2 symmetry and the 1,3,5‐trithiane ring has a twist–boat conformation. The C—S—C bond angles within the ring are about 8° larger than observed in most related 1,3,5‐trithiane structures. In dispiro1,2,4‐trithiolane‐3,2′:5,2′′‐diadamantane], C20H28S3, the molecules have local C2 symmetry and the 1,2,4‐trithiolane ring has a half‐chair conformation. |
